Mark Lillibridge wrote:

>>  So I cannot see that blank lines are going missing (unless going from
>>  Babyl to mbox adds one, and going the other way subtracts one?).
>
>     You got it!  Examine the BABYL file and you will see that Rmail 22.3
> has added an extra blank line after each of your messages.  That was a
> recent (pre transformation to 23) RMAIL bug, I believe.  My older email
> does not have these extra blank lines. 

It sort of makes me wonder if it is worth changing this now, because if
most BABYL files started life as mbox files but were converted by Emacs,
then they have an extra blank line.

But anyway, I installed this.
